Hướng dẫn is max a method in python? - max có phải là một phương thức trong python?

❮ Chức năng tích hợp sẵn

Show


Định nghĩa và cách sử dụng

Hàm

for
0 trả về mặt hàng có giá trị cao nhất hoặc mặt hàng có giá trị cao nhất trong một điều khác.

Nếu các giá trị là chuỗi, một so sánh theo thứ tự bảng chữ cái được thực hiện.


Cú pháp

Hoặc:

Giá trị tham số

Tham sốSự mô tả
N1, N2, N3, ...Một hoặc nhiều mục để so sánh

Hoặc:

Tham sốSự mô tả
N1, N2, N3, ...Một hoặc nhiều mục để so sánh

Có thể lặp lại

Một điều đáng tin, với một hoặc nhiều vật phẩm để so sánh

Nhiều ví dụ hơn

Thí dụ

Trả lại tên với giá trị cao nhất, theo thứ tự bảng chữ cái:

Một điều đáng tin, với một hoặc nhiều vật phẩm để so sánh

Nhiều ví dụ hơn

Thí dụ
x = max(a)

Trả lại tên với giá trị cao nhất, theo thứ tự bảng chữ cái:


X = Max ("Mike", "John", "Vicky")

Hãy tự mình thử »


❮ Chức năng tích hợp sẵn


Max () là một hàm sẵn có trong ngôn ngữ lập trình Python trả về ký tự bảng chữ cái cao nhất trong một chuỗi.eturns the largest item in an iterable or the largest of two or more arguments.

Được xây dựng tối đa

  • Bạn có thể gặp phải một tình huống mà bạn muốn tìm giá trị tối thiểu hoặc tối đa trong danh sách hoặc chuỗi. Ví dụ, bạn có thể viết một chương trình tìm thấy chiếc xe đắt nhất được bán tại đại lý của bạn. Đó là nơi các hàm tích hợp của Python Min () và Max () xuất hiện.
  • Hàm Python Max () trả về mục lớn nhất trong một đối số có thể lặp lại hoặc lớn nhất trong hai hoặc nhiều đối số.

Bạn có thể gặp phải một tình huống mà bạn muốn tìm giá trị tối thiểu hoặc tối đa trong danh sách hoặc chuỗi. Ví dụ, bạn có thể viết một chương trình tìm thấy chiếc xe đắt nhất được bán tại đại lý của bạn. Đó là nơi các hàm tích hợp của Python Min () và Max () xuất hiện.

Hàm Python Max () trả về mục lớn nhất trong một đối số có thể lặp lại hoặc lớn nhất trong hai hoặc nhiều đối số.

Nó có hai hình thức.max(arg1, arg2, *args[, key]) 

hàm tối đa () với các đối tượng

  • chức năng tối đa () với có thể điều chỉnh được objects of the same datatype
  • Không giống như hàm tối đa () của c/c ++, hàm tối đa () trong Python có thể lấy bất kỳ loại đối tượng nào và trả về lớn nhất trong số đó. Trong trường hợp chuỗi, nó trả về giá trị lớn nhất về mặt từ vựng.multiple objects
  • Cú pháp: Max (arg1, arg2, *args [, key]) & nbsp;function where comparison of iterable is performed based on its return value

Tham số: & nbsp;The maximum value 

arg1, arg2: các đối tượng của cùng một kiểu dữ liệu

*Args: Nhiều đối tượngFinding the maximum of 3 integer variables

Python3

Khóa: Hàm trong đó so sánh có thể thực hiện được dựa trên giá trị trả về của nó

Trả về: Giá trị tối đa & NBSP;

Ví dụ về hàm python max ()

Ví dụ 1: Tìm mức tối đa của 3 biến số nguyên

geeks
4
geeks
5

Đầu ra: & nbsp;

8

for1for2 for3Finding the maximum of 3 string variables

for
4
for
2
for
6

Python3

for
7
for
2
for
9

geeks
0__12
geeks
223

Ví dụ 2: Tìm tối đa 3 biến chuỗi

Ví dụ 1: Tìm mức tối đa của 3 biến số nguyên

geeks
4
geeks
5

Đầu ra: & nbsp;

for

for1for2 for3Finding the maximum of 3 string variables according to the length

for
4
for
2
for
6

Python3

for
7
for
2
for
9

geeks
0__12
geeks
223

Ví dụ 2: Tìm tối đa 3 biến chuỗi

& nbsp; theo mặc định, nó sẽ trả về chuỗi với giá trị từ vựng tối đa. & nbsp;

The maximum is at position 6
4
The maximum is at position 6
5
for
2
The maximum is at position 6
7
The maximum is at position 6
8

geeks
4
geeks
5

Đầu ra: & nbsp;

geeks

for1for2 geeks8

for
4
for
2
TypeError: '>' not supported between instances of 'str' and 'int'
1

Python3

for
7
for
2
TypeError: '>' not supported between instances of 'str' and 'int'
4

Ví dụ 3: Tìm tối đa 3 biến chuỗi theo độ dài

Chúng tôi sẽ chuyển một hàm chính trong phương thức tối đa (). & Nbsp;

geeks
4
geeks
5

Đầu ra: & nbsp;

TypeError: '>' not supported between instances of 'str' and 'int'

geeks0for2 geeks22

Python3

Ví dụ 4: Python Max () Ngoại lệ

Nếu chúng ta vượt qua các tham số của các kiểu dữ liệu khác nhau, thì một ngoại lệ sẽ được nêu ra.

geeks
4
Geeks
9

Output:

1.3

s
1
for
2
s
3

Python3

s
4
for
2
TypeError: '>' not supported between instances of 'str' and 'int'
4

geeks
0
for
2
geeks
22.

Ví dụ 5: Python Max () Float

for
3
for
2
for
5
for
6__777778 ____777__

for
21
The maximum is at position 6
7
{1: 'Geek'}
7

Output:

The maximum is at position 6

Hàm Python Max () trả về mục lớn nhất trong một đối số có thể lặp lại hoặc lớn nhất trong hai hoặc nhiều đối số.

Nó có hai hình thức.

hàm tối đa () với các đối tượngmax(iterable, *iterables[, key, default]) 
Parameters : 

  • chức năng tối đa () với có thể điều chỉnh đượciterable object like list or string.
  • Không giống như hàm tối đa () của c/c ++, hàm tối đa () trong Python có thể lấy bất kỳ loại đối tượng nào và trả về lớn nhất trong số đó. Trong trường hợp chuỗi, nó trả về giá trị lớn nhất về mặt từ vựng.multiple iterables
  • Cú pháp: Max (arg1, arg2, *args [, key]) & nbsp;function where comparison of iterable is performed based on its return value
  • Tham số: & nbsp;value if the iterable is empty

arg1, arg2: các đối tượng của cùng một kiểu dữ liệuThe maximum value. 

*Args: Nhiều đối tượngFinding the lexicographically maximum character in a string

Python3

Khóa: Hàm trong đó so sánh có thể thực hiện được dựa trên giá trị trả về của nó

Trả về: Giá trị tối đa & NBSP;

geeks
4
geeks
5

Đầu ra: & nbsp;

s

Ví dụ về hàm python max ()Finding the lexicographically maximum string in a string list

Python3

Ví dụ 1: Tìm mức tối đa của 3 biến số nguyên

geeks
0
for
2
geeks
2
for
45

geeks
4
geeks
5

Đầu ra: & nbsp;

for

Ví dụ 3: Tìm chuỗi dài nhất trong danh sách chuỗi.Finding the longest string in a string list.

Python3

for
33
for
2
for
5
for
36
for
77____31
for
77
for
555____81

geeks
0
for
2
geeks
2
for
60
for
2
The maximum is at position 6
7
The maximum is at position 6
8

geeks
4
geeks
5

Đầu ra: & nbsp;

Geeks

Ví dụ 3: Tìm chuỗi dài nhất trong danh sách chuỗi.If the iterable is empty, the default value will be displayed

Python3

for
33
for
2
for
5
for
36
for
77____31
for
77
for
555____81

geeks
0
for
2
geeks
2
for
60
for
2
The maximum is at position 6
7
The maximum is at position 6
8

The maximum is at position 6
4
for
74
for
2
for
76
for
04
for
78
for
55
for
80

geeks
4
geeks
5

Đầu ra: & nbsp;

{1: 'Geek'}

Max () là một phương thức hoặc hàm?

Sự mô tả.Vì Max () là một phương pháp toán học tĩnh, bạn luôn sử dụng nó như Math.Max (), thay vì là phương pháp của một đối tượng toán học bạn đã tạo (toán học không phải là một hàm tạo).a static method of Math , you always use it as Math.max() , rather than as a method of a Math object you created ( Math is not a constructor).

Max có phải là một đối số trong Python không?

Hàm Python Max () trả về mục lớn nhất trong một đối số có thể lặp lại hoặc lớn nhất trong hai hoặc nhiều đối số.Nó có hai hình thức.. It has two forms.

Max có phải là một hàm chuỗi không?

Max () là một hàm sẵn có trong ngôn ngữ lập trình Python trả về ký tự bảng chữ cái cao nhất trong một chuỗi..

Được xây dựng tối đa

Bạn có thể gặp phải một tình huống mà bạn muốn tìm giá trị tối thiểu hoặc tối đa trong danh sách hoặc chuỗi.Ví dụ, bạn có thể viết một chương trình tìm thấy chiếc xe đắt nhất được bán tại đại lý của bạn.Đó là nơi các hàm tích hợp của Python Min () và Max () xuất hiện.Python's built-in functions min() and max() come in.